#6deb90 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6deb90 is composed of 42.7% red, 92.2%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.7%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 136.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 67.5%. #6deb90 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#00d721.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#6deb90

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010903 is the darkest color, while #f7f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6deb90

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6b2aa is the less saturated color, while #5afe87 is the most saturated one.
